secuencia: ejecución de una sentencia tras otra.selección o condicional: ejecución de una sentencia o conjunto de sentencias, según el valor de una variable booleana.
¿Qué es la programación estructurada y cuáles son sus características?
La programación estructurada es una teoría orientada a mejorar la claridad, calidad y tiempo de desarrollo utilizando únicamente subrutinas o funciones. Basada en el teorema del programa estructurado propuesto por Böhm y Jacopini, ha permitido desarrollar software de fácil comprensión.
¿Cuáles son las funciones de programación estructurada?
La programación estructurada busca dividir o descomponer un problema complejo en pequeños problemas. La solución de cada uno de esos pequeños problemas nos trae la solución del problema complejo. En el lenguaje C el planteo de esas pequeñas soluciones al problema complejo se hace dividiendo el programa en funciones.
¿Cuáles son las características de la programación?
- Sintaxis: el conjunto de símbolos y reglas para formar sentencias.
- Semántica: las reglas para transformar sentencias en instrucciones lógicas.
- Pragmática: utilizando las construcciones particulares del lenguaje.
¿Cuáles son las ventajas de la programación estructurada?
Ventajas de la programación estructurada Se optimiza el esfuerzo en las fases de pruebas y depuración. El seguimiento de los fallos o errores del programa (debugging), y con él su detección y corrección, se facilita enormemente. Se reducen los costos de mantenimiento.
¿Qué tipos de estructuras existen en programación?
En programación estructurada se utilizan tres tipos de estructuras: secuenciales, aquellas que se ejecutan una después de otra siguiendo el orden en que se han escrito; de decisión, que permiten omitir parte del código o seleccionar el flujo de ejecución de entre dos o más alternativas; y las iterativas, que se …
¿Qué es un lenguaje estructurado de programación?
Un lenguaje estructurado tiene una sintaxis, una semántica y una pragmática y su objetivo es comunicar en forma no verbal, – a los diferentes actores involucrados (personas, maquinas, constructores,..) -, instrucciones orientadas a determinar acciones e interacción entre ellos.
¿Cuáles son los 3 tipos de lenguaje de programación?
- Lenguaje máquina.
- Lenguajes de programación de bajo nivel.
- Lenguajes de programación de alto nivel.
¿Cuáles son las características de la programación orientada a objetos?
El paradigma de la programación orientada a objetos consiste en la representación de la realidad. En éste se manejan algunos conceptos básicos como son clases, objetos, atributos, métodos y se caracteriza por emplear la abstracción de datos, herencia, encapsulamiento y polimorfismo.
¿Como debe de ser un lenguaje de programación?El lenguaje de programación debe ser implementable en una computadora, es decir; debe ser posible ejecutar un programa en términos del lenguaje en cualquier máquina. … Los lenguajes naturales tampoco son implementables por razones totalmente diferentes: ellos son tan imprecisos y tienden a ser muy ambiguos.
Article first time published on¿Cuáles son las 4 estructuras de la programación?
- Estructura Secuencial.
- Estructuras de Repetición.
- Estructuras Condicionales.
¿Cuál es la estructura de la función?
La estructura de una función comienza con un signo igual (=), seguido por el nombre de la función, un paréntesis de apertura, los argumentos de la función separados por comas y un paréntesis de cierre.
¿Cuáles son los tipos de estructuras de control?
Las estructuras de control se pueden clasificar en: secuenciales, iterativas y de control avanzadas. Esta es una de las cosas que permiten que la programación se rija por los principios de la programación estructurada. Los lenguajes de programación modernos tienen estructuras de control similares.
¿Qué es la programación estructurada desventajas?
– Facilita la detección de fallas. Desventajas: – Complicada visualización y manejo en programas grandes. – No permite la reutilización de código.
¿Cuáles son las ventajas de la programación orientada a objetos?
- Fomenta la reutilización y ampliación del código.
- Permite crear sistemas más complejos.
- La programación se asemeja al mundo real.
- Agiliza el desarrollo de software.
- Facilita el trabajo en equipo.
¿Cuáles son las desventajas de la programación?
VentajasDesventajasCódigo más corto y eficiente.En parte, difícil de comprender para personas ajenas.Realizable con métodos no conocidos en el momento de la programación.Basado en una forma de pensar no habitual en las personas (estado de solución).
¿Cuántos tipos de estructuras de datos existen?
- Arrays. La estructura de datos más simple es el array lineal (o unidimensional). …
- Pila. …
- Cola. …
- Grafos. …
- Recorrido. …
- Búsqueda. …
- Inserción. …
- Eliminación.
¿Cuáles son los 4 pilares fundamentales de la programación orientada a objetos?
- Pilar 1: Encapsulación. El concepto de encapsulación es el más evidente de todos. …
- Pilar 2: Abstracción. Este concepto está muy relacionado con el anterior. …
- Pilar 3: Herencia. …
- Pilar 4: Polimorfismo.
¿Qué es la programación orientada a objetos cuáles son sus pilares?
Estos pilares son: abstracción, encapsulamiento, herencia y polimorfismo.
¿Qué es una clase en POO características?
Dentro de la programación orientada a objetos, las clases son un pilar fundamental. Una clase es la descripción de un conjunto de objetos similares; consta de métodos y de datos que resumen las características comunes de dicho conjunto. … … Cada objeto creado a partir de la clase se denomina instancia de la clase.
¿Cuál es el mejor lenguajes de programación?
Python, sin duda, encabeza la lista. Es ampliamente aceptado como el mejor lenguaje de programación para aprender primero. Python es un lenguaje de programación rápido, fácil de usar y fácil de implementar que se está utilizando ampliamente para desarrollar aplicaciones web escalables.
¿Cuáles son los niveles de la programación?
- Lenguaje máquina. Es el más primitivo de los códigos y se basa en la numeración binaria, todo en 0 y 1. …
- Lenguajes de programación de bajo nivel. …
- Lenguajes de programación de alto nivel. …
- Java. …
- Lenguaje de programación C. …
- Python. …
- C++ …
- C#
¿Cuál es el mejor lenguaje de programación?
Python es probablemente el mejor lenguaje de programación para aprender, especialmente si no trabajas en un campo específico de programación. Te será fácil aprender a programar Python especialmente si sabes otro lenguaje, pero sigue siendo un excelente lenguaje para novatos.
¿Cuántas clasificaciones de instrucciones hay en un lenguaje de programación?
Lenguajes de programación imperativos: entre ellos tenemos el Cobol, Pascal, C y Ada. Lenguajes de programación declarativos: el Lisp y el Prolog. Lenguajes de programación orientados a objetos: el Smalltalk y el C++. Lenguajes de programación orientados al problema: son aquellos lenguajes específicos para gestión.
¿Qué es un lenguaje de programación imperativo?
Los lenguajes de programación imperativa son como unas instrucciones paso a paso (cómo) redactadas para el ordenador. Describen de forma explícita qué pasos deben llevarse a cabo y en qué secuencia para alcanzar finalmente la solución deseada.
¿Qué son las estructuras básicas?
Las Estructuras Básicas pueden ser: Secuenciales: cuando una instrucción del programa sigue a otra. Constan de Entrada, Proceso y Salida. Selección o decisión: acciones en las que la ejecución de alguna dependerá de que se cumplan una o varias condiciones.
¿Qué representa el Tipo_de_retorno dentro de la estructura de una función?
El tipo_de_retorno representa el tipo de dato del valor que devuelve la función. Este tipo debe ser uno de los tipos simples de C, un puntero a un tipo de C o bien un tipo struct. De forma predeterminada, se considera que toda función devuelve un tipo entero (int).
¿Cuál es la estructura de la función SI en Excel?
Use la función SI, una de las funciones lógicas, para devolver un valor si una condición es verdadera y otro si es falsa. Por ejemplo: =SI(A2>B2;”Presupuesto excedido”;”Correcto”) =SI(A2=B2;B4-A4;””)
¿Qué es una función en Excel y cuáles son sus partes?
Una función es una fórmula predefinida que realiza los cálculos utilizando valores específicos en un orden particular. Una de las principales ventajas es que ahorran tiempo porque ya no es necesario que las escribas tú mismo.
¿Cuáles son las estructuras de control simple?
Las estructuras selectivas simple, lo que realiza primero es la lectura de datos, posteriormente evalúa la expresión lógica si esta es verdadera se ejecutan las siguientes instrucciones en caso de que la expresión lógica se falsa no se realiza nada y termina el proceso y solo utiliza las palabras de Si entonces (If, …
¿Cómo se utilizan las estructuras de control?
La estructura de control for permite ejecutar un bloque de instrucciones un número determinado de veces mientras se cumpla una condición. … Después se ejcuta la instrucción de incremento y vuelve a comprobarse la condición. Así sucesivamente hasta que la condición no se cumple.